Why Uncontested Divorce?

There are various benefits to an uncontested divorce as opposed to a courtroom divorce. First and foremost, there is the matter of time and money that is typically involved in a  contested divorce in a Jacksonville courtroom. Another primary issue to consider, however, is the fact that you may be able to reach more agreeable divorce terms by reaching an agreement on your own rather than having a judge rule upon these matters. When you undergo an uncontested divorce in Jacksonville, you and your spouse are able to reach your own agreement about custody and visitationproperty division and support based upon your unique situation, schedules and preferences - as opposed to a decision rendered by a judge who does not know all the particulars of your unique case.
